#d28cbd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d28cbd is composed of 82.4% red, 54.9%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 10%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 318 degrees, a saturation of 43.8% and a lightness of 68.6%. #d28cbd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a5197b.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#d28cbd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d28cbd has RGB values of R:210, G:140,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.1,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13798589.

Shades and Tints of #d28cbd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c050a is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d28cbd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3abb1 is the less saturated color, while #fd61ce is the most saturated one.
